18. Birth
“. . . . So x equals 24 in this case.”
Marty nodded, smiling up at Doc. “Thanks, Doc. It makes a lot more sense now.”
“Glad to help,” Doc replied, smiling back. “Care to try a problem on your own now?”
“Yeah.” Marty looked over the next problem, then went to work. Doc stepped back and observed his friend. Once again, he debated the wisdom of involving Marty in the upcoming time travel experiment. Things were just so -- different now. At least, different than he was sure they had been the first time around.
After all, the Marty McFly who had visited him back in 1955 had been male.
Doc shook his head. Amazing what changes can happen from one trip into the past. Marty’s interference with his parent’s first meeting has changed his -- her -- whole life -- and mine as well. It was rather shocking to find her in my garbage cans three years ago, instead of the boy I was expecting. . . .
His eyes strayed over to the almost-completed DeLorean. In one month, he would conduct a temporal experiment at the local mall, and Marty would be catapulted back to 1955. What would happen to her then? Would she somehow change into her male counterpart? Would there be two Marty McFlys back there, one of each sex? Or would the ripple effect change his memories so that he always recalled it being a girl who showed up on his front step with the fantastic story of being a time traveler?
Only one way to see, Doc thought with a shrug. He just hoped that, whatever happened, it wouldn’t have a detrimental effect on Marty. Boy or girl, he still felt an extreme fondness for the teenager. Though I’ll always wonder exactly what he did to cause himself to be born female this time around. . . . .
Marty -- Martina -- looked up. “I think I’ve got it. Mind checking it over?”
“Not at all.” Doc took his seat next to his friend and began reviewing her math.
